Some will know that one of my nephews, Paul Keegan, tragically died 2 years ago during a camping weekend in the Lake District. The nominated charity for donations from the time of the funeral has been the Forget Me Not Trust.

The Forget Me Not Trust has been set up with the specific purpose of providing what is a sadly lacking facility in West Yorkshire, to provide respite care to children who are critically or terminally ill and support to their families.

Myself and one of Paul’s cousins, Edward McLoughland decided to undertake a charitable event in commemoration of Paul’s life, with any monies raised from the event going to the Forget Me Not Trust.

Well the big day has come and gone and I am pleased to report that my nephew and I each completed 100 holes of golf in a single day, on the 4th July 2008, at Longley Park Golf Club Huddersfield.

The day started for me at 3.30 am, at which point I did question my own sanity. As planned we had both teed off at the 1st by 4.20 am in semi gloom, as the sun was struggling to rise over the horizon. The first 18 holes were quite surreal as we had the course to ourselves, a faint mist hung in the air and quietness all around. The weather was fantastic during the day, with only a light breeze and sunshine, although we did get through a fair amount of fluid as the middle of the day was very warm. We kept up a steady pace and knocked off hole after hole, stopping only for half an hour at 9.30 am for breakfast and 20 minutes at 3.45 pm for lunch. We felt up against the clock all day, and this was very much the case towards the back end of the day. At 4.05 pm we still had 36 holes to complete, which at 3 hours a round meant completing the holes within day light hours was achievable but only if we maintained a brisk pace from thereon in, which bearing in mind we had already been on the course for 12 hours was going to be tough. But we did manage to do it, sinking the last putt at 10.10 pm, however by this point it did appear that we were auditioning for the "Ministry of Funny Walks", and both of us were both physically and mentally exhausted.

The 101st hole at the bar was much needed, which assisted soothing the pain of the aching muscles, creaking joints and blistered feet.

For the record, 17 hours of actual playing time, the 100 holes took me 534 shots, I managed to score 1 birdie, 10 pars and 4 scores of 10, 3 of which were on the same hole, and I managed to lose numerous golf balls. The competition on the day with my nephew was match play, which remarkably was not decided until the 99th green, when he made par to win 2 and 1.

Most importantly I managed to far exceed my fund raising target, which is down to the fantastic generosity of those I approached to sponsor me. Accordingly on behalf of The Forget Me Not Trust and myself, very many thanks for your support, it was really appreciated, and it undoubtedly played a significant part in keeping me going during the day.
